Transaction cd79c95c578daaaf4fa5280962aec6b0a90d7e135e6ecf3353ad4d1186c3c974

2 Input
2 Outputs
  • cd79c95c578daaaf4fa5280962aec6b0a90d7e135e6ecf3353ad4d1186c3c974:0
  • value  3717887
    address  15TEr6ccHHvpt3pcynvkP3mj4mcsxtgwf9
  • cd79c95c578daaaf4fa5280962aec6b0a90d7e135e6ecf3353ad4d1186c3c974:1
  • value  100000000
    address  1Eo5saZeCo8yc3WAsgtJz3h66K6RZWCmPr